Swiatek was born on May 31, 2001, in Warsaw, Poland. She began playing tennis at the age of four and quickly rose through the junior ranks. She won the Wimbledon girls' singles title in 2018 and the French Open girls' singles title in 2019.
Swiatek turned professional in 2019 and quickly made a name for herself on the WTA Tour. She won her first WTA title in 2020 at the Adelaide International and has since gone on to win 10 WTA titles, including two Grand Slams.
